Helium — the universe's second most abundant element — has become, paradoxically, one of Earth's most precarious resources. A conflict-driven closure of Qatar's Ras Laffan facility in March 2026 erased a third of global supply overnight, sending prices doubling and forcing the world to confront how deeply modern medicine and digital technology depend on a gas most people associate with balloons. The crisis is less a story of scarcity than of concentration — of what happens when the infrastructure of civilization is quietly routed through a handful of fragile chokepoints.

Geopolitical Impact
Geopolitical disruption of helium supply from Qatar's closure threatens critical medical imaging and semiconductor manufacturing globally, with prices surging 100% and supply rationing beginning.
Qatar's helium production shutdown shifts leverage to remaining suppliers (US, Russia), potentially strengthening their negotiating position. Iran-related geopolitical tensions demonstrate how regional conflicts weaponize critical resource dependencies. US and Russia gain strategic advantage in semiconductor and medical technology sectors.
Similar to 1973 OPEC oil embargo—weaponization of critical resource supply to exert geopolitical pressure, though helium's irreplaceability in specific applications makes substitution more difficult than oil.
Economic Lens
Geopolitical disruptions have triggered a 100% helium price surge, threatening critical medical imaging and semiconductor manufacturing sectors globally.
Consumers face potential delays and increased costs for MRI medical imaging, higher prices for semiconductors affecting smartphones and AI devices, and reduced access to non-critical helium applications. Healthcare costs may rise due to equipment scarcity.
Governments likely to: (1) Develop strategic helium reserves; (2) Invest in alternative cooling technologies for medical/semiconductor industries; (3) Negotiate helium supply agreements with producing nations; (4) Incentivize helium recycling infrastructure; (5) Accelerate R&D for helium-independent technologies; (6) Consider supply chain diversification away from geopolitically volatile regions.
